As F.L.A.G. was launched in 1982 as a dream of Wilton Knight. His dream came true just prior to his passing but under the supervision of Devon Miles, long time employee of Wilton and trusted friend. They embarked on a crusade to bring law and order to those who's power or control made them feel they were above the law. To that end, a man needed to be found to implement the values of F.L.A.G. The man they found was police officer, Michael Long.

Michael Long during the investigation was shot in the face in the line of duty and left for dead. F.L.A.G. brought Michael back, and repaired him as well as reconstructed his face. After that Michael Knight was born instead of Michael Long, he was recruited by F.L.A.G. as their operative in the field. At Michael's disposal or more to the point his partner was the Automated Pontiac Trans AM heavily modified from the ground up. The Car was state of the art in many categories including engine speed, Oil slick, ejector seats, several other tricks and technologies. Most important technology however was the on board thinking and reasoning microprocessing computer named the Knight Industries Two Thousand or K.I.T.T. for short.

The Car and its technological sophistications with Michael Knight behind the wheel over the next several years took out some of the worst corruption of its time. taking out criminals that thought they were above the law.

Several years later in 2008 a second attempt was made to recreate the FLAG ideal with only limited success, this time a Ford Mustang GT 500 was recreated for the Knight Industry's Three Thousand. And after only a year the project was mothballed by unknown persons.
